WebBrowser.ShowSaveAsDialog WebBrowser.ShowSaveAsDialog WebBrowser.ShowSaveAsDialog WebBrowser.ShowSaveAsDialog Method


Opens the Internet Explorer Save Web Page dialog box or the Save dialog box of the hosted document if it is not an HTML page.

 void ShowSaveAsDialog();
public void ShowSaveAsDialog ();
member this.ShowSaveAsDialog : unit -> unit
Public Sub ShowSaveAsDialog ()


The following code example demonstrates how to use the ShowSaveAsDialog method to implement a Save As menu option that is similar to the one on the Internet Explorer File menu. This example requires that your form contains a menu with a menu item called MenuItemFileSaveAs and a WebBrowser control called webBrowser1.

// Displays the Save dialog box.
void MenuItemFileSaveAs_Click( System::Object^ /*sender*/, System::EventArgs^ /*e*/ )

// Displays the Save dialog box.
private void saveAsToolStripMenuItem_Click(object sender, EventArgs e)
' Displays the Save dialog box.
Private Sub saveAsToolStripMenuItem_Click( _
    ByVal sender As Object, ByVal e As EventArgs) _
    Handles saveAsToolStripMenuItem.Click


End Sub


You can use this method to implement a Save As menu item similar to the one on the Internet Explorer File menu. The dialog box that appears when this method is called depends on the document type currently loaded.


This method allows users to save only the contents of the document as it was originally loaded. Any modifications made to the document at run time through the Document property are not persisted. For information on retrieving the run-time modifications, see How to: Access the HTML Source in the Managed HTML Document Object Model.


for immediate callers to use this control. Demand value: LinkDemand; Named Permission Sets: FullTrust.

to access the printer through this method. Demand value: Demand. Associated enumeration: DefaultPrinting.

Applies to

See also